Description

A lightweight yet durable 9-step aluminium ladder designed for safety and convenience.

The Ladder 9-Step Aluminium Total THLAD06091 is designed to offer optimal safety and convenience for both professional and personal use. Crafted from high-quality aluminium, this ladder is lightweight yet robust, ensuring durability and stability. It features nine steps that are strategically spaced to provide a comfortable climb while ensuring maximum reach. Ideal for various tasks around the home or at the workplace, this ladder is corrosion-resistant, making it suitable for indoor and outdoor use. The non-slip feet ensure the ladder stays firmly in place, providing added safety. Enhance your productivity and safety with this essential tool that combines functionality with a sleek design.

Key Features

• Lightweight aluminium construction
• Nine strategically spaced steps
• Corrosion-resistant for indoor and outdoor use
• Non-slip feet for stability
• Sleek and functional design

Specifications

Specification: Value
Material: Aluminium
Number of Steps: 9
Weight Capacity: 150 kg
Height: 3 meters
Usage: Indoor and Outdoor
